Other Keyhole Operation On An Endocrine Gland

Kansas rates for HCPCS 60659

Covers a keyhole operation on a hormone-producing gland, such as the adrenal or thyroid gland, when the procedure performed has no standard named entry of its own. The surgeon works through small cuts using a camera and long instruments instead of a single large incision. The operative report sets out exactly what was done.
